Course Content

• Introduction to IoT and its Environmental Impact in Manufacturing
• Sustainable Manufacturing Practices and IoT Technologies
• IoT Sensors and Data Acquisition for Environmental Monitoring (Air Quality, Water Usage, Energy Consumption)
• Data Analytics and Visualization for Environmental Performance Improvement
• Implementing IoT for Waste Reduction and Recycling in Manufacturing
• Lifecycle Assessment and IoT in Green Manufacturing
• IoT-enabled Energy Management and Optimization in Manufacturing
• Case Studies: Successful IoT Implementations for Environmental Sustainability in Manufacturing
• Legislation and Regulations related to Environmental Impact and IoT in Manufacturing
• The Future of IoT and Sustainable Manufacturing: Emerging Technologies and Trends

Career path

Career Role in IoT Environmental Impact (UK) Description
IoT Environmental Consultant Analyze environmental impact of manufacturing processes, advise on IoT solutions for optimization and sustainability. High demand for expertise in IoT sensors, data analytics, and environmental regulations.
Sustainability Engineer (IoT Focus) Develop and implement IoT-based systems for monitoring and reducing emissions in manufacturing. Requires strong skills in IoT device management, data visualization, and sustainable manufacturing principles.
IoT Data Scientist (Environmental Applications) Analyze large datasets from IoT sensors to identify areas for environmental improvement in manufacturing. Requires advanced skills in data analysis, machine learning, and IoT data integration.
Manufacturing Process Optimization Specialist (IoT) Improve efficiency and reduce waste in manufacturing processes using IoT technologies. Needs expertise in process engineering, IoT connectivity, and automation.
